A 41 year old man should aim for 7-9 hours of sleep per night to maintain optimal health and well-being. However, individual sleep needs can vary, so it's important for him to listen to his body and adjust accordingly. A consistent sleep schedule and good sleep hygiene practices can also help improve the quality of sleep.
Most elderly adults should aim for 7-9 hours of sleep per night. However, individual sleep needs can vary, so it's important to pay attention to how rested the person feels during the day to determine if they are getting enough sleep. Additionally, naps during the day can help supplement nightly sleep if needed.

"Melatonin" is a hormone produced by the pineal gland in the brain that helps regulate sleep and wake cycles. It is also available as a dietary supplement and is sometimes used to help improve sleep quality or treat certain sleep disorders.
No, neither cinnamon nor honey have been found useful for weight loss. Cinnamon is being investigated for a possible role in diabetes and stabilization of blood glucose levels; and honey is simply another source or carbohydrates high in fructose for the body.

There is no direct scientific evidence to suggest that honey specifically makes you sleepy. However, consuming honey before bed may help promote better sleep due to its role in stabilizing blood sugar levels and promoting the release of serotonin, which can aid in relaxation.
